The New Native Foods "Meatball Sub"

I have to admit hesitancy prior to pulling the trigger on my latest Native Foods lunch order. Was I really going to order a vegan "Super Italian Meatball Sub?" More so, if I were to order this so-called sandwich, is there any effin' way I would like it?

In retrospect, I am happy I had the balls to order the balls. Obviously, there is a stigma associated with vegan foods -- it simply does not taste as good as the "real" thing to non-vegans. No matter how hard the veganarians fight to assure us it tastes just as good, it almost never does. Trying to persuade me that something vegan is worth eating is akin to getting a hard core righty to admit public health care is the way to go.

BUT... that does not mean some vegan food cannot rise above the others. Krissys cookies, for example. And, I'm happy to report, the Super Italian Meatball Sub as well. While certainly not in the LA Meatball Sandwich Pantheon with such luminaries as All About the Bread, Bay Cities and Fraiche, it is still mighty tasty. Like they demonstrate successfully with their "fried chicken," Native Foods does a great job of masking the seitan meat balls with various seasonings, and, in this case, marinara sauce, caramelized onions, roasted sweet peppers, pumpkin seed pesto, the house ranch and faux Parmesan.

Overall, a solid, filling sandwich that I would certainly order again.
